For standard steel, 16 gauge is approximately 0.0598 inches (1.519 mm) thick. Gauge to thickness chart (click here for a printable pdf chart) gauge. The thickness of 16 gauge steel depends on the type of steel being measured. Gauge (ga.) is a length.
